What is Web Mining? Definition of Web Mining: Is the application of data mining techniques (association rules finding, clustering, classification etc.) to web data, in order to discover useful patterns. According to analysis targets, web mining can be divided into three different types, which are web usage mining, web content mining and web structure mining, and an emerging area web opinion.
